following on from a topic on the message board,its about time this piece of dundee heritage made a long overdue return in my opinion.

going back to my youth there was no better sight than seeing the sporting post arrive at the local newsagent,you would most definately be standing in a large queue with your exact money ready.

up the road and you had to hand it over to your father so he could check the pools results that were formed by a long coloum at the bottom

 of either the 1st or last page.then right to the dundee game even if you had been to the match,it was a must read,the home team always took the front page so it was utd one week and the dees the next.

there was also great local football coverage including junior football matches and indeed the saturday juvenile and bb scores.50

if i remember correctly there was also a bowling section,for the aulder lads,and not to mention the upto date league tables,oh how i miss that paper,i would definately pay a pound for the return of the olde dundee favourite that was the sporting post,as i got older it was quite funny arriving off the 7 oclock bus from the dundee clubby after a match half gassed up the stairs ,a beady glare from the mrs and tea banged down on the table haha,best bit was i would then try and read the post through one eye.bring back the sporting post dc's and quickly.
